Marina Chesapeake Bay

Looking for a good marina in the North Eastern Bay for the summer 2017.
I draw 5.5 ft and hit bottom in Tolchester and Worton Creek. Paid $ 2800 for the summer season dockage. Any suggestions?

Re: Marina Chesapeake Bay

Depends on the amenities, service capabilities, & atmosphere you are looking for.
Haven Harbour in Rock Hall is one of the best in the area w/ knowledgable service staff.
Green Point Landing & the Wharf @ Handy's Point are both excellent, no nonsense, dockage.
Various other Rock Hall options.
For a S/V, The Fredericktown marina's on the Sassafras are a motor up there, the advantage is that the water there is consider "fresh".
Langford Bay is always cost effective & has, or is getting new ownership.

Lots of options to suit various needs & desires.

Re: Marina Chesapeake Bay

Depending on your needs, we've used Hance's Point YC. It's very North being just South of North East but they have moorings that will accommodate your S/V. Great social and sailing club and probably one of the least expensive.
